Output d9721c5c18a85ef930c8b2685f13ba8b137d25ad515ba98e08d53fbd2aa23b9a:1

value
28309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 560bbae1176148d744460baf2dc2837ce0b5342d OP_EQUAL
address
39Xz64BVD2n4w4zDPmAScz6kyE1RTU8ae5
transaction
d9721c5c18a85ef930c8b2685f13ba8b137d25ad515ba98e08d53fbd2aa23b9a
confirmations
303686
spent
true